Suppliers Bargaining Power
Porsche Automobil Holding SE, via its stake in Volkswagen AG, depends on suppliers for specialized parts like advanced semiconductors and EV batteries. These niche components often have unique specifications, limiting the pool of qualified manufacturers. For instance, the automotive industry's reliance on advanced chipsets, critical for modern vehicle functions, saw significant supply chain disruptions in 2021-2022, impacting production volumes and leading to price increases for these essential inputs.
Raw material price volatility significantly impacts the automotive sector, affecting companies like Porsche SE through its stake in Volkswagen AG. For instance, lithium prices, crucial for electric vehicle batteries, saw substantial swings in 2023, with some benchmarks experiencing declines of over 50% from their 2022 peaks, illustrating the unpredictable nature of these essential inputs.
Suppliers of key materials such as lithium, cobalt, nickel, steel, and aluminum can wield considerable bargaining power. This power intensifies when global demand for these commodities outpaces supply, or when geopolitical events disrupt their extraction and processing, as seen with various supply chain challenges in recent years.
Porsche SE's profitability is indirectly exposed to these cost pressures. When raw material costs rise, manufacturers may be forced to absorb these increases or pass them on to consumers, impacting sales volumes and margins throughout the automotive value chain.
The automotive industry, including major players like Volkswagen Group (which Porsche Automobil Holding SE oversees), is experiencing significant supplier consolidation. This means fewer, larger companies are controlling key components and technologies. For instance, in 2024, the semiconductor shortage highlighted how concentrated the chip supply chain is, giving dominant chip manufacturers considerable leverage over automakers.
When a few suppliers dominate a market segment, their bargaining power naturally increases. They can command higher prices and impose stricter contract terms. This situation directly impacts Volkswagen Group's ability to negotiate favorable pricing for essential parts, potentially affecting production costs and profit margins. The reliance on a small number of suppliers for critical technologies like advanced battery components or specialized electronic control units amplifies this power.

Switching Costs and Vertical Integration
The bargaining power of suppliers for Volkswagen AG, a major entity within the Porsche Automobil Holding, is significantly influenced by switching costs. These costs are substantial for an automotive giant, involving expenses for re-tooling production lines, obtaining new certifications for components, and reconfiguring intricate global supply chains. For instance, a shift from a long-standing supplier of critical engine components could easily run into tens of millions of euros in development and validation alone.
This high barrier to switching inherently strengthens the position of existing suppliers. They benefit from the inertia created, making it economically challenging for Volkswagen to change partners even if better terms are theoretically available elsewhere. This can lead to less favorable pricing and contract terms for the automaker.
While the Volkswagen Group possesses considerable internal production capabilities through its various brands and factories, complete vertical integration across all component manufacturing remains impractical. This strategic decision means that a significant portion of its supply chain relies on external partners, thus preserving a degree of power for these suppliers in negotiations.

Customers Bargaining Power
For Porsche's luxury marques, customer bargaining power is somewhat tempered by robust brand loyalty and an aspirational image. Buyers of these high-end vehicles often value heritage, performance, and design above mere price, a sentiment reflected in Porsche's consistent ability to command premium pricing. For instance, in 2023, Porsche reported an operating profit margin of 18.2%, underscoring its strong pricing power.
Customers within the Volkswagen Group's diverse brand portfolio, which includes Porsche, Audi, and Skoda, face a vast selection of alternative vehicles. This spectrum ranges from direct rivals in both the premium and mainstream automotive sectors to innovative electric vehicle startups.
This abundance of substitutes, readily accessible through extensive online research and comparison tools, significantly enhances a customer's ability to scrutinize features, pricing, and service offerings. For instance, in 2024, the global automotive market saw a significant increase in EV options, with over 300 distinct EV models available worldwide, giving consumers more choices than ever before.
Consequently, this heightened awareness and the sheer volume of available alternatives empower customers, amplifying their bargaining power. They can more easily negotiate prices or switch to a competitor if perceived value is not met, particularly in segments where product differentiation is less pronounced.

Rivalry Among Competitors
The automotive sector, where Porsche Automobil Holding SE has its stake via Volkswagen AG, is a battlefield of fierce global competition. Every segment, from affordable compacts to high-end luxury vehicles, sees major manufacturers like Toyota, Stellantis, and BMW Group locked in a constant struggle for dominance.
This intense rivalry forces companies to engage in aggressive pricing, accelerate innovation, and invest heavily in marketing to capture market share. For instance, in 2024, the global automotive market saw sales exceeding 70 million units, highlighting the sheer volume and competitive intensity.
The pressure on profit margins is relentless, compelling firms to continually refine their strategies and operational efficiencies. This dynamic environment means that staying ahead requires not just producing cars, but anticipating market shifts and consumer desires with remarkable speed and precision.
Competitive rivalry in the automotive sector is intense, driven by a constant push for product differentiation. This includes advancements in design, performance, cutting-edge technology, and a growing emphasis on sustainability. Companies are in a fierce innovation race, especially concerning electric vehicles (EVs), autonomous driving capabilities, and in-car connectivity.
The Volkswagen Group, which includes Porsche, faces significant pressure to innovate. In 2024, the global automotive market saw continued investment in EV technology, with major players like Tesla, BMW, and Mercedes-Benz introducing new models and expanding their electric lineups. For instance, Volkswagen Group's own investment in electrification reached billions of euros, aiming to launch numerous new EV models across its brands by 2025.
This innovation race means that staying ahead requires not just developing new features but also integrating them effectively across a broad brand portfolio. Volkswagen Group's success hinges on its ability to leverage its scale and R&D capabilities to bring advanced technologies to market efficiently, competing with rivals who are also pouring substantial resources into these transformative areas.
The automotive sector, including companies like Porsche, faces intense competition driven by substantial fixed costs. These costs, encompassing research and development, sophisticated manufacturing facilities, and broad distribution networks, create a significant barrier to entry and a constant pressure to operate at high capacity. For instance, the automotive industry's capital expenditures are notoriously high; in 2023, major automakers invested tens of billions globally into new technologies and production, underscoring this reality.
This reliance on high capacity utilization means that any dip in demand or the introduction of new production lines can force manufacturers into aggressive pricing strategies to keep their plants running efficiently. In 2024, we've seen reports of increased incentives and discounts on certain vehicle models across various brands as companies strive to maintain production volumes and avoid the crippling effects of underutilized assets, directly impacting profit margins industry-wide.

SSubstitutes Threaten
The rise of public transportation and ride-sharing services presents a growing threat to traditional car ownership, impacting brands like Volkswagen. In 2023, ride-sharing services facilitated billions of trips globally, with companies like Uber and Lyft reporting significant user growth. This trend is particularly pronounced in urban centers, where congestion and parking challenges make alternatives more appealing.
For mass-market brands within the Volkswagen Group, these substitutes can diminish the perceived need for personal vehicle ownership. Younger demographics, in particular, are increasingly opting for mobility-as-a-service models, prioritizing convenience and cost-effectiveness over outright ownership. This shift could lead to reduced demand for entry-level and mid-range vehicles.
The proliferation of micromobility solutions like electric scooters and e-bikes presents a growing threat, particularly in urban areas. These options offer a cost-effective and convenient alternative for short trips, directly impacting the demand for smaller vehicles within the automotive sector.
In 2024, the global micromobility market was valued at an estimated $100 billion, projected to grow significantly. This trend can reduce car usage for daily commutes, potentially affecting sales volumes for compact and city cars that Volkswagen Group, a major stakeholder in Porsche, offers.
For Porsche's luxury segment, the threat of substitution is significant as affluent consumers can direct their substantial discretionary spending towards a variety of high-end categories. Instead of purchasing a new luxury vehicle, these individuals might opt for exclusive travel experiences, premium real estate investments, or high-fashion apparel. This broadens the competitive landscape beyond just other automotive brands.
In 2024, the global luxury goods market was projected to reach over $300 billion, showcasing the immense competition for consumer attention and spending. Porsche needs to consistently highlight its unique brand heritage, engineering excellence, and emotional appeal to ensure its cars remain a compelling choice against these diverse luxury alternatives.

Durability and Longevity of Existing Vehicles
The increasing durability and longevity of vehicles represent a significant threat of substitutes for new car sales. Consumers are holding onto their existing vehicles for longer periods, a trend amplified by improvements in automotive engineering and quality. For instance, the average age of vehicles on U.S. roads reached a new record of 12.5 years in 2023, up from 12.1 years in 2021, according to S&P Global Mobility data. This extended lifespan means fewer customers are in the market for a new vehicle each year, directly impacting demand across all segments, including those served by Volkswagen Group brands.
This substitution of a new purchase with continued use of an older, well-maintained vehicle directly challenges the sales volume of manufacturers like Porsche Automobil Holding. When consumers can rely on their current cars for an additional few years, the urgency to upgrade diminishes. This can lead to slower sales cycles and reduced revenue potential for the entire automotive industry, as consumers delay replacement purchases and opt for repairs or upgrades to their existing assets.
The impact of this trend is felt across the automotive spectrum. Even premium brands, where technological advancements and performance upgrades are key selling points, face this threat. The economic incentive to avoid the depreciation and initial cost of a new vehicle often outweighs the desire for the latest features, especially when older models remain reliable and functional.

Entrants Threaten
The automotive sector, including luxury brands like Porsche, demands colossal upfront investment. Establishing research and development capabilities, state-of-the-art manufacturing plants, robust global supply chains, and extensive distribution networks can easily run into billions of dollars. For instance, developing a new electric vehicle platform alone can cost upwards of $10 billion, a figure that immediately erects a significant hurdle for any aspiring competitor.
These substantial capital requirements act as a powerful deterrent to new entrants. Potential players must secure immense funding to even begin competing on a meaningful scale, let alone achieve profitability or establish a recognizable brand. This financial barrier significantly limits the pool of viable new competitors, thereby safeguarding established automakers, including those within the Volkswagen Group umbrella, from immediate, disruptive threats.
Established brand loyalty and distribution networks present a significant barrier for new entrants in the automotive industry, particularly for luxury brands like Porsche. Companies like Porsche and Volkswagen have cultivated decades of trust and preference among consumers, making it difficult for newcomers to gain traction. In 2024, the automotive market continues to see strong brand affinity, with established players often commanding higher resale values and customer retention rates.
The automotive sector faces significant regulatory barriers, with global standards for safety, emissions, and environmental impact constantly evolving. For instance, in 2024, many regions are tightening emissions regulations, requiring substantial investment in research and development for compliance.
New entrants must invest heavily in obtaining certifications and approvals, a process that can take years and cost millions. These compliance costs, covering everything from crash testing to exhaust gas analysis, directly inflate the capital required to enter the market.
For example, meeting the Euro 7 emissions standards, which are becoming more stringent, necessitates advanced catalytic converters and particulate filters, adding considerable expense to vehicle production. This creates a high cost of entry for any new player aiming to compete with established automakers like Porsche.

Economies of Scale and Supply Chain Integration
Established automotive giants, including players like Volkswagen Group which owns Porsche, leverage massive economies of scale. In 2024, the sheer volume of production for major manufacturers translates into substantial cost advantages in sourcing raw materials and components. This deeply entrenched supply chain integration, honed over decades, makes it incredibly difficult for newcomers to match the per-unit cost efficiencies and production capabilities of incumbents.
New entrants face a significant hurdle in replicating the optimized supply chains and bulk purchasing power of established automakers. For instance, a new electric vehicle startup would struggle to negotiate prices for battery cells or rare earth minerals at the same level as a company producing millions of vehicles annually. This cost disparity directly impacts their ability to compete on price and achieve profitable production volumes from the outset.
